PeaceMaker was formed in the late nineties in Oldham, when a group of young British Asians, deeply concerned by the depressing slide into segregation which they were witnessing around them, started to take action to halt that decline.

The young men who formed PeaceMaker had a simple aim: to create opportunities for young people to meet and befriend other people from different communities and ethnicities.
